Celebrating with Heart and Community: National Day with KCCCC

On 2 August 2025, a contingent of staff proudly represented TRANS Family Services at Kampong Chai Chee Community Club’s National Day Observance Ceremony at Heartbeat@Bedok.

More than just a celebration, the invitation was a meaningful recognition of our dedication to the community and a reminder of the strong bonds we share with the people we serve. We are honoured to stand alongside our community partners and neighbours in marking Singapore’s birthday, and we look forward to continuing this journey of care and connection together.
